Raincliffe Woods

 

An area of mixed woodland on the outskirts of Scarborough.

How to get there: 

The trail begins at the Hazel Hill car park, which is situated at the junction of the Forge Valley, Hackness and Scalby roads.

How long does it take: 

2.5 hours to complete the trail.

How to follow the trail:

The route is set with footpaths and bridle-ways, and a set of numbered posts.

Take the footpath from the car park down through the woodland and walk down the Hackness Rd. to the start of the trail on the opposite side.
